Tripura: Ruling BJP suffers one other jolt as Karbook MLA quits get together; he is the fourth to resign this yr

3 min read

By Express News Service

GUWAHATI: The ruling BJP in Tripura suffered a jolt on Friday when MLA Burba Mohan Tripura resigned from the get together in addition to the Assembly.

The veteran chief, who represented the Karbook constituency, will be a part of the tribe-based get together Tipraha Indigenous Progressive Regional Alliance (TIPRA).

Accompanied by TIPRA chief and former state Congress president Pradyot Bikram Manikya Deb Barman, the legislator submitted his resignation letter to Speaker Ratan Chakraborty.

Deb Barman confirmed Tripura would be a part of the TIPRA.

“He has resigned from the BJP and the Assembly. I accompanied him to express my solidarity with him. He will join now TIPRA,” Deb Barman instructed journalists.

After Tripura’s resignation, the BJP’s power within the 60-member House received decreased to 35. Leaders of the get together weren’t obtainable for remark.

Tripura is the fourth BJP legislator to ditch the get together previously one yr. Ashis Das, former minister Sudip Roy Barman and Ashis Kumar Saha had abandoned the get together after falling out with former Chief Minister Biplab Kumar Deb.

Roy Barman and Saha had joined the Congress in February this yr whereas Das had worn the Trinamool Congress colors final yr however left the get together in May this yr. Roy Barman is now a Congress MLA after having received a by-election earlier this yr.

The former CM Deb was elected to Rajya Sabha on Thursday. He had defeated CPI-M candidate and former minister Bhanulal Saha by 28 votes. The election was necessitated by the resignation of Manik Saha who was appointed because the CM in May.

The TIPRA, which holds sway within the 20 seats in tribal areas, is predicted to offer the BJP a run for its cash within the Assembly elections.

These seats had been historically the CPI-M’s strongholds. Now, the Left get together has nearly misplaced the house to the TIPRA. The CPI-M has appointed Jitendra Choudhury, a tribal, because the state normal secretary to heat as much as the man tribals and regain the misplaced floor.

The Assembly elections in Tripura can be held by March 2023.
